Resetting Taxes for Supplier Resources

Whenever a new tax is added for a locality (country, state/province, and so on), you may need to add that tax to supplier resources for the suppliers that are in that locality. You can update the tax settings on all of a supplier’s resources at one time.
This method resets the taxes on each supplier resource. You can also reset the taxes on any extra charges applicable to the resource’s prices. The currently listed taxes are deleted and replaced by the taxes listed on the supplier’s country, state or province, and locality.
Note: You will not be able to use this method to delete taxes that are no longer applicable to a locality. You must manually delete the taxes from each supplier resource.
